Starbucks, Hannaford, Turkey Hill Wraps and Salads Recalled

Greencore USA of Rhode Island is recalling 1,341 pounds of meat and poultry products that are produced without the benefit of federal inspection and outside inspection hours. They have the brand names Starbucks, Hannaford, and Turkey Hill. No confirmed reports of adverse reactions have been received to date.

Starbucks Wrap RecallThe meat and poultry wrap and salad items were made on April 7, 14, 18, 21, and 25, 2016. They include Starbucks Southwest Style Steak Wrap in 7.7 ounce packages with use-by dates of 4/10/2016 and 4/24/2016. Also recalled are Starbucks Thai-Style Peanut Chicken Wrap in 8.2 ounce packages, with use-by dates of 4/10/2016 and 4/17/2016. Starbucks Zesty Chicken & Black Bean Salad Bowl in 9.5 ounce packages with a use by date of 4/28/2016 is recalled.

Also recalled are Hannaford Italian Pesto Wrap in 7.8 ounce packages with a use by date of 4/25/2016. Hannaford Asian-Style Salad in 7 ounce packages is recalled, with a use by date of 4/30/2016. And finally, Turkey Hill Fresh To Go Grilled Chicken Ranch Wrap in 9.9 ounce packages, with a use-by date of 4/23/2016 is recalled. These products all have the establishment number P-45540″ inside the USDA mark of inspection. They were shipped to distributors for sale in Connecticut, Maine,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York and Rhode Island.

If you purchased any of these products, do not eat them. Throw them away or return them to the store where you bought them for a full refund. You can see pictures of product labels at the USDA web site.
